What Does a Supplemental Insurance Agent in Ventura Cost?

Supplemental insurance costs in California vary by plan type age and location. Medigap Plan G premiums for a 65-year-old in Ventura typically range from 120 to 250 dollars per month. Medicare Advantage plans often have low or zero monthly premiums but may include copays and deductibles. Some agents receive commissions from insurers while others charge a flat fee. This is general information and not insurance advice.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is a supplemental insurance agent in Ventura?
A supplemental insurance agent in Ventura is a licensed professional who helps you buy policies like Medigap Medicare Supplement or Medicare Advantage. They explain plan differences and assist with enrollment. Agents must follow California insurance regulations and cannot charge you a fee for their service.
When can I enroll in a Medigap plan in California?
California law gives you a six-month Medigap open enrollment period starting when you first enroll in Medicare Part B at age 65 or older. During this time you can buy any Medigap policy without medical underwriting. Outside this window insurers may ask health questions and can deny coverage.
Do I need a supplemental insurance agent in Ventura?
Working with an agent can help you compare plans from different companies and find one that fits your budget and health needs. Agents know which local hospitals and doctors accept each plan. In California agents must provide you with a written outline of coverage before you buy.
